Angelique Boyer’s Journey: From Rebelde Star to Doménica Montero

Angelique Boyer is a renowned name in the world of telenovelas, with a career that spans nearly two decades. Her journey from a supporting actress in “Rebelde” to her current role as Doménica Montero demonstrates her evolution in the industry.
Early Career and Breakthrough
Boyer began her acting career in 2004 with a special appearance in “Corazones al límite,” playing a character named Anette. That same year, she joined the popular telenovela “Rebelde” as one of the best friends within a group of students.
At just 16 years old, Boyer secured her first significant opportunity. This role marked the beginning of her impressive trajectory in the entertainment industry.
Role in “Corazón Salvaje”
One of her notable performances was in “Corazón Salvaje,” where she played a dual role as sisters Jimena and Ángela. Jimena, the mystical and vibrant character, left a lasting impression on viewers, showcasing Boyer’s transition into adult roles.
Rise to Stardom with “Teresa”
Her portrayal of Teresa Mendoza in the influential telenovela “Teresa” catapulted Boyer to stardom. The series solidified her status as a leading actress and continues to circulate on social media, where memorable scenes are shared frequently. Boyer has mentioned that certain scenes from the show moved her to tears.
Follow-Up Success: “Abismo de Pasión”
Boyer’s subsequent role in “Abismo de Pasión” further established her talent. The series, a successful remake, was sold to over 50 countries, allowing Boyer to explore a more sensual character, Elisa Castañón Bouvier.
Modern Interpretation in “El extraño retorno de Diana Salazar”
In “El extraño retorno de Diana Salazar,” Boyer took on the challenge of a well-known character originally made famous by Lucía Méndez. Her modern interpretation of Leonor added depth and intensity to the story, highlighting her acting capabilities.
The New Role: Doménica Montero
Now, Boyer faces a new challenge with her role as Doménica Montero. This character is part of a remake of a story originally by Inés Rodena. The story has seen successful adaptations every fifteen years, notably as “La Dueña” with Lucero and “Soy tu dueña” with Angélica Rivera.
In this latest adaptation, Boyer starts as a kind and naïve woman but evolves into a ruthless character. This journey promises to keep audiences engaged, as Boyer continues to prove her versatility and talent in the competitive world of telenovelas.
